Question 3: Briefly describe what important role retrieval language plays in information retrieval. Retrieval language plays an extremely important role in information retrieval. It is a bridge between information storage and information retrieval. In the process of information storage, it is used to describe the content and external characteristics of information, thus forming a retrieval logo; In the process of retrieval, it is used to describe the retrieval problem, thus forming a question mark; When the question mark and the search mark completely or partially match, the result is a hit to the document.

It is pointed out that China Library Classification is the abbreviation of China Library Classification, and it is a common tool for book classification in China at present. If readers master the relevant knowledge of this classification, they can quickly and effectively search the collections of libraries all over the country.
Basic structure of classification
(1) Basic categories: For example, China Library Classification is divided into five categories: Marxism-Leninism, Mao Zedong and Deng Xiaoping; Philosophy; Social science; Natural science; Comprehensive books.
(2) Basic category: the first category that constitutes the classification table. There are 22 basic categories in China Library Classification.

(4) Detailed List: A list of categories consisting of various registered categories is the real basis for literature classification.
According to the characteristics of books and materials, the classification system is determined according to the principle of compiling from total to sub-division and from general to specific, and 22 categories are formed on the basis of 5 basic categories. The symbol of China Library Classification adopts the mixed number of Chinese phonetic alphabet and * * * number. That is, a letter represents a big category, and the order of big categories is embodied in alphabetical order. The letters are followed by numbers, indicating the division of the following categories. Numbers are numbered in decimal.
